Oubliettes 03/22/22 12:02:11 PM #38: | catacombs, caves, graves, mines, ruins, etc are fucking awesome full of secrets, hidden pathways, interesting use of the environments, etc. pro tip for catacombs: are they a little samey? yeah, insofar as they use the same assets and enemies. but i feel like the design approach is really reminiscent of older games, in that the early ones are kind of easy, and introduce all the mechanics one by one. middle game ones start combining them, so you're dealing with multiple mechanics at once after you've (hopefully) mastered them individually. and end game ones start throwing curve balls where you have to solve them in unique and interesting ways. and tbh, i appreciate that you're given multiple opportunities to learn, practice, master, and apply the same mechanics. in a game this big, i feel like having to learn unique movesets for 200 bosses would start to feel like a chore. learning crystalian A pattern, then learning crystalian B pattern, then fighting crystalian A and B at the same time, then having to learn crystalian C while you're fighting ABC all at once feels like a more natural progression and i like those little "aha! I know how to deal with those guys!" moments. the only boss i felt was overused was the godskin guys, but i feel like there's lore implications to that. --- http://i.imgur.com/ozVGOuh.png ...
